Resident Evil Requiem, the latest mainline entry in Capcom’s long-running survival horror series, was recently confirmed for Switch 2, launching on 27th February 2026.

Now, thanks to the game’s appearance at Tokyo Game Show 2026, we now have footage of Requiem running on the Switch 2 via handheld mode, as kindly highlighted by Stealth40K on X.
